  • If you only want an opinion, mine is birth control pills. I took varying brands of them for nearly 15 years without any gaps. I never got pregnant while taking them and had very few, mild side effects. It only took a few months for me to get pregnant after stopping them too. After my baby arrives, I will either go back on the pill or get an IUD. I need to talk to my doctor before I make that decision.

  • Several forms are pretty effective (95% or higher if used properly).  Our birth control decision post baby #1 was tied to the fact that I was breast feeding.  I had a brief conversation with my care providers a month or two before I was due and we went over some of the common options.  I made my final decision right before my 6 week PP appointment as that is typically when you'll start the pill or have a device implanted (IUD or implantable).  My suggestion is to talk with your care provider as s/he will be able to offer you the options that will be most effective in your situation.
